The Executive Branch

 

The Executive branch is lead by President Tania Sue Maestas. It is made up by President Tania Maestas, Vice-President of Internal Affairs- Alejandra Baca, Vice-President
of External Affairs- Pedro Diaz. This branch is devoted to administering the daily operations of the organization and formally overseeing the Legislative Branch.

 

The Legislative Branch

The Legislative Branch consists of twenty senators: twelve at-large senators representing the student body and eight collegiate senators. The Senate passes bills and allocates funds to students and/or student organizations for University related projects, events, or travels. Legislative tasks are divided among a large number of committees, which represent the issues affecting student body.

 

The Judicial Branch

JudicialThe Judicial Branch is the portion of the Student Government that decides cases arising from the student community. This branch is composed of the Supreme Court,Traffic Court, Public Defenders, and the Chief Prosecutor/ Attorney General.
